Abstract | The Illinois Early Learning Project (IEL) is funded by the Illinois State Board of Education to provide information resources on early learning and training related to implementing the Illinois Early Learning Standards for parents and for early childhood personnel in all settings. The IEL tip sheets offer suggestions to parents and early childhood personnel on a variety of topics related to children's early experiences. This set of three tip sheets, in English- and Spanish-language versions, relates specifically to children and the fine arts. The titles are as follows: (1) Drama and Young Children"; (2) "Things To Do while You're Waiting: Art Works!"; (3) "Things To Do while You're Waiting: Music, Sound, and Movement." (LPP) |
